1*c66ec88fSEmmanuel Vadot* Adaptrum Anarion ethernet controller 2*c66ec88fSEmmanuel Vadot 3*c66ec88fSEmmanuel VadotThis device is a platform glue layer for stmmac. 4*c66ec88fSEmmanuel VadotPlease see stmmac.txt for the other unchanged properties. 5*c66ec88fSEmmanuel Vadot 6*c66ec88fSEmmanuel VadotRequired properties: 7*c66ec88fSEmmanuel Vadot - compatible: Should be "adaptrum,anarion-gmac", "snps,dwmac" 8*c66ec88fSEmmanuel Vadot - phy-mode: Should be "rgmii". Other modes are not currently supported. 9*c66ec88fSEmmanuel Vadot 10*c66ec88fSEmmanuel Vadot 11*c66ec88fSEmmanuel VadotExamples: 12*c66ec88fSEmmanuel Vadot 13*c66ec88fSEmmanuel Vadot gmac1: ethernet@f2014000 { 14*c66ec88fSEmmanuel Vadot compatible = "adaptrum,anarion-gmac", "snps,dwmac"; 15*c66ec88fSEmmanuel Vadot reg = <0xf2014000 0x4000>, <0xf2018100 8>; 16*c66ec88fSEmmanuel Vadot 17*c66ec88fSEmmanuel Vadot interrupt-parent = <&core_intc>; 18*c66ec88fSEmmanuel Vadot interrupts = <21>; 19*c66ec88fSEmmanuel Vadot interrupt-names = "macirq"; 20*c66ec88fSEmmanuel Vadot 21*c66ec88fSEmmanuel Vadot clocks = <&core_clk>; 22*c66ec88fSEmmanuel Vadot clock-names = "stmmaceth"; 23*c66ec88fSEmmanuel Vadot 24*c66ec88fSEmmanuel Vadot phy-mode = "rgmii"; 25*c66ec88fSEmmanuel Vadot }; 26